Do not disable the daemon to restore service. Verify the signed restart log first; missing entries indicate possible tampering and warrant a severity-1 page to the on-call platform lead. Anything involving modified watchdog binaries goes straight to the incident channel, no triage. For audit questions, config-change approvals, or to report a suspected bypass, write to the security escalation contact at the address below.

alerts address for faduf-yajeg: drumir@nelvroworks.internal

QUARTERLY PLANNING NOTE — Insurance Renewal

Sales leads: the Harrowgate liability policy renews at quarter-end. Premiums rise modestly; coverage terms for client site visits stay the same. Hold off quoting any custom indemnity clauses until the renewal is signed. Expected completion is week three of the quarter. Relevant strategy detail follows below.

board note of kageg-bahof: The renewal with Holwynax Holdings closes at $2 million a year, 5 percent below the last contract. Project Ulaath slips by two quarters because of the supplier delay.

## PixWarden EXIF Scrubbing: Limits & Quotas

Every upload passes through the PixWarden scrubber before hitting storage, so if it backs up, uploads back up. The queue is sized for normal traffic plus one viral spike; past that, oversize images get deferred rather than dropped. If paged, check queue depth against these limits first:

tuning table, yajog-yahof:
BUDGETS = {
    "lamvan": 303,
    "wenox": 460,
    "fenvan": 525,
}

Fernhook's public REST API paginates with opaque cursors. Cursors expire after 15 minutes and are bound to the issuing token, so they cannot be replayed across sessions. Page size caps at 200. Enumeration of deleted resources returns empty pages, not errors. To exercise the internal pagination test harness, authenticate with the key below.

service key, tadup-tahog: zpat7_wB1tnEL